About the St. John's → Toronto route

St. John's to Toronto is a funny little route. It's barely 2,122 km — closer to a regional hop than anything you'd call a real haul — yet it connects the easternmost city in North America to the country's commercial engine. You're in the air for around two and a half hours, which is just long enough to eat a sad sandwich and wonder why you didn't just drive (you shouldn't drive, for the record). Air Canada runs this corridor heavily, and it attracts a real mix of passengers: Newfoundland government workers, oil and gas contractors, students heading west, and families doing the long-distance thing.

Practical tips for YYT → YYZ

Book shoulder season — late September or early May — if you want lower fares and weather that doesn't punish you. Summer is pricier and YYZ gets congested. Speaking of YYZ: Pearson is big, loud, and occasionally chaotic. Budget extra time if you're connecting. The UP Express train runs from Terminal 1 directly to Union Station downtown in about 25 minutes and costs a fraction of what a cab will take you for. If you're flying Flair (F8) or Porter (PD), check your baggage allowance before you pack — carry-on restrictions on low-cost carriers here will catch you off guard if you're used to Air Canada's defaults.

Frequently asked questions

How long is the flight from St. John's to Toronto?

The flight covers approximately 2,122 km and takes about 2 hours and 30 minutes of flight time. This makes it a relatively short domestic flight across eastern Canada.

Which airlines fly the St. John's to Toronto route?

Four airlines operate this route: Air Canada (AC), Flair Airlines (F8), Porter Airlines (PD), and WestJet (WS). You'll have multiple options to compare schedules and fares.

What's the best time of year to fly this route?

Late spring through early fall (May–September) offers the best balance of pleasant weather in both cities and competitive fares, while winter months can bring flight disruptions due to St. John's weather. Shoulder seasons (April and October) are also good for fewer crowds and reasonable prices.

Do I need a visa to fly from St. John's to Toronto?

No visa is required—both cities are in Canada, so this is a domestic flight for Canadian citizens and permanent residents. International visitors should ensure their Canadian entry requirements are met before arrival in St. John's.

What should I know about luggage, jet lag, and connections on this route?

Luggage policies vary by airline, so check your carrier's allowances in advance. Jet lag is minimal on this domestic route with only a 30-minute time difference, and the short flight time means you'll arrive in Toronto with minimal fatigue—ideal for same-day connections if needed.
